Raben Steinfeld is located on the southeastern shore of Lake Schwerin, north of the Lewitz lowlands. The town lies between Lake Pinnow and Lake Schwerin on a watershed, where Lake Schwerin is higher than Lake Pinnow.
Geographical Location
Raben Steinfeld is situated on Federal Highway 321 and near Federal Motorway 14.
Nature and Landscape
Almost half of Raben Steinfeld is forested and forms part of a nature and landscape conservation area. Flakenwerder and Kaninchenwerder are located nearby. The surrounding area also includes Swan Island and Tannenwerder (Dead Island).
Culture and History
The former hunting lodge in Raben Steinfeld was converted into the grand ducal summer residence of Mecklenburg-Schwerin in 1886–1887. Historic stud farm keepers’ houses from 1863–1869, built in the neo-Gothic Scottish style, have been preserved along Leezener Straße.
